Now that New Zealand is open to vaccinated travelers, you may be planning an epic adventure to the islands. This could include visiting the “Lord of the Rings” Hobbiton in the North Island, hiking the Tongariro Alpine Crossing, and cruising around Cathedral Cove.

A trip to New Zealand is expensive and can require many non-refundable prepaid deposits to book flights, accommodation, tours, excursions and private guides.

Because you have so much at stake on your trip, it’s wise to protect your investment in case something unexpected derails your plans. The best travel insurance policies include coverage for:

The average cost of travel insurance for a trip to New Zealand is just $260, according to a Forbes Advisor analysis of travel insurance rates. Generally, the cost of travel insurance is 5% to 6% of the cost of your trip.

Here’s what to look for in a travel insurance plan for a trip to New Zealand.

Trip Cancellation Insurance for Missing Mud Baths in Rotorua

There is no way around it: New Zealand is on the other side of the world and taking a trip there is expensive. If an unforeseen event causes you to cancel your vacation, you could lose your hard-earned money to insure your trip if you don’t have trip cancellation insurance.

Let’s say that three days before your departure, your spouse is hospitalized after a car accident. You may need to cancel your travel plans. If you have trip cancellation travel insurance, you would be eligible to file a claim and recover 100% of your prepaid, non-refundable, unused travel expenses.

Reasons that are generally covered by trip cancellation insurance include:

A list of acceptable reasons to cancel will be outlined in your travel insurance policy and may vary significantly from one travel insurance company to another. Please review your policy details to learn what qualifies as a trigger for trip cancellation benefits.

Cancel for any reason travel insurance for opting out of Auckland

Please note that not all reasons for canceling a trip are covered by a standard travel insurance policy. For example, if a week before your trip you decide to cancel because your childcare arrangements did not come through, this would not be a reason covered by your trip cancellation insurance.

For the freedom to change your mind, you can add “cancel for any reason” travel insurance to your standard policy. But you can cancel your trip for any reason, as long as you do so at least 48 hours before your scheduled departure.

“Cancel for any reason” insurance generally reimburses 75% of prepaid non-refundable travel costs. Please note that you must generally purchase this additional coverage within 14-21 days of making your initial trip deposit.

Travel Delay Insurance: Waiting for Wellington

A typical trip from New York to Auckland can take 30 hours and include two or more stops. An example of a typical New Zealand itinerary might be from Baltimore to Los Angeles to Sydney to Auckland. What if your flight from Los Angeles to Sydney is canceled due to torrential rain in Southern California and you need to rebook your flight for the next day? That’s when your travel delay insurance benefits can help pay for associated layover costs.

You can be reimbursed, up to your policy limits, for a hotel stay, meals, a taxi ride, and some personal necessities to get you through until you catch your next flight. Be sure to save all receipts because you need to submit documentation when you file your claim.

If you miss out on a prepaid guided tour of Wellington’s Food Trails due to delay, you can also make a claim to be reimbursed for that loss.

Be sure to check the waiting period for travel delay benefits. Trip delay coverage kicks in after a specified period of time, for example six or 12 hours.

Reasons that will generally be covered by your travel delay insurance include severe weather and airline mechanical issues. If you fall asleep in the airport lounge and miss your connecting flight, you can’t rely on your travel insurance for financial help.

Trip Interruption Travel Insurance for Cutting Out of Queenstown

No one goes on a trip expecting to get home early, but it can happen if an emergency occurs at home. You may decide that you need to cut your trip short and fly home as soon as possible.

Your comprehensive travel insurance policy with trip interruption travel insurance can be the saving grace that helps you cover the cost of a one-way plane ticket home.

You can also recover unused, non-refundable travel expenses that you lost due to your unexpected departure from New Zealand. If you prepaid for a hotel in Queenstown, made non-refundable payments for a wine tour and a chartered boat tour, your trip interruption insurance may reimburse you.

Death in the immediate family, illness or injury to you, a traveling companion or close relative, or a serious family emergency are generally covered by trip interruption benefits.

Not all reasons to cut your trip short will be covered by travel insurance. Consider “trip interruption for any reason” travel insurance if you want the flexibility to come home no matter the cause. It is an optional add-on that reimburses up to 75% of the cost of your trip. Generally, you must be at least 48 hours into your trip for benefits to apply.

You typically need to purchase “break for any reason” coverage within 14 to 20 days of booking your trip, and it typically adds 3% to 10% to the cost of your travel insurance.

Travel Medical Expense Insurance for Milford Sound Mishaps

When you travel outside of the US, your domestic health insurance may not be accepted. The best way to be prepared for any type of international travel is to call your US-based health care provider to see if global benefits are offered. Also, senior travelers should be aware that Medicare is not accepted abroad.

Purchasing a policy with travel medical insurance and emergency medical evacuation coverage is vital when traveling to foreign destinations.

If you cruise Milford Sound, slip on the wet deck and break a few ribs, you’ll need medical attention. Your health insurance covers the cost of medical exams, X-rays, lab work, doctor and hospital visits, and medications, up to your policy limits.

If you suffer a serious injury or illness while traveling and need emergency transportation to a facility equipped to treat you, emergency medical evacuation coverage helps cover the cost.

Your travel insurance company can send a medical evacuation and cover the costs related to your transportation to the nearest medical facility that can provide you with adequate care.

“Medical evacuation costs increase with distance and can reach six figures for long air ambulance trips,” explains Durazo. “Any time you leave the country, and especially to a destination far from home, it’s smart to consider a plan with emergency medical benefits.”

Baggage Insurance for When Suitcases Are in the Wop-wops

Baggage insurance provides benefits if your baggage or personal belongings are lost, damaged, or stolen. You may be compensated for the depreciated value of your belongings, up to your policy limits.

Exclusions apply, so be sure to check your policy to find out what is and is not refundable. Also, be sure to file a report with your tour operator or local authorities if a loss occurs. You will be required to submit this documentation when filing a claim.

If your bags arrive later than you and you need to buy a change of clothes and some toiletries, you can recoup your costs with baggage delay benefits. Please note that baggage delay insurance usually kicks in after a period of time specified in your policy, such as 12 hours.

Sports and Adventure Considerations for New Zealand Travel

New Zealand offers a wide variety of adventure sports and activities. “Everything from hiking, skiing, surfing, diving, whitewater rafting to bungee jumping, caving and repelling,” says Meghan Walch, a spokeswoman for InsureMyTrip, a travel insurance comparison website.

She says that these activities may be considered risky by insurance companies. It is important to check your travel insurance policy to find out if your benefits apply if you are injured during one of these activities. Policies may exclude adventure sports or have limited coverage, Walch says.

If you want coverage for high-risk fun, look for a travel insurance company that offers additional coverage for adventure sports and activities.

How expensive should travel insurance be?

While travel insurance costs vary, the average is between 4-12% of the total cost of the trip*. If you’re on the fence, consider this: An emergency situation can cost tens of thousands of dollars, but the insurance plan can be a fraction of the cost of your trip.

Does travel insurance become more expensive as the departure date approaches? Unlike other aspects of your travel experience, such as airfares or hotel room rates, the price of travel insurance does not increase as you get closer to your travel date. There’s no financial penalty if you wait to purchase travel insurance (except for bonus coverages, of course).

How long should your travel insurance be for?

Annual travel insurance is designed to provide emergency medical and medical evacuation coverage for multiple trips over the course of a year. These policies are valid for one year from the start date, which must be the departure date of your first trip.

What is the average cost of travel insurance?

The average cost of travel insurance is 5% to 6% of your trip costs, based on Forbes Advisor’s analysis of travel insurance rates. For a $5,000 trip, the average cost of travel insurance is $228, with rates ranging from $154 for a basic policy to $437 for a policy with generous coverage.

Do UK citizens get free healthcare in New Zealand?

Under a reciprocal health arrangement, UK citizens living in the UK who are on a short-term visit to New Zealand are eligible for immediately necessary medical care under the health system on the same terms. than New Zealand citizens.
